What is OpenAI Chat?
OpenAI Chat refers to a series of advanced language models developed by OpenAI, designed to understand and generate human-like text. These models are built upon deep learning techniques and vast datasets, enabling them to comprehend context, answer questions, and engage in meaningful conversations with users.
Key Features
- Natural Language Understanding: One of the standout features of OpenAI Chat is its ability to understand and process natural language inputs. This allows for more fluid and natural interactions between humans and machines.
- Contextual Awareness: The models are equipped with the capability to maintain context over extended interactions, ensuring that responses are relevant and coherent throughout the conversation.
- Diverse Applications: From customer service bots to personal assistants, OpenAI Chat is versatile enough to be integrated into a wide range of applications across different industries.
- Continuous Improvement: The models are continually updated and refined based on user feedback and advancements in AI research, ensuring they remain at the forefront of technology.

How does OpenAI Chat work?
OpenAI Chat operates using advanced language models that are trained on vast datasets to understand and generate human-like text. At its core, these models utilize deep learning techniques, specifically neural networks, to process and interpret natural language inputs. When a user inputs a question or prompt, the model analyzes the text to comprehend its context and intent. It then generates a coherent and contextually appropriate response based on patterns it has learned from training data. The system’s ability to maintain context over multiple interactions allows it to engage in meaningful conversations, making it highly effective for applications ranging from customer support to personal assistance. By continuously learning from new data and user interactions, OpenAI Chat improves over time, enhancing its accuracy and relevance in various conversational scenarios.
